A chatbot is a program that interacts with users through chat interfaces like messaging apps. Chatbots are simple and inexpensive to develop and deploy, and allow asynchronous notifications and integration with teams. To build a chatbot, you define a grammar for commands, program actions for the bot to take, and define how it will return results to the user. Advanced features include integrating webhooks and slash commands for more capabilities. Security measures like restricting commands and using tokens are also important to implement.
